What are Paige Bueckers’ NIL deals as of 2025?
Paige Bueckers has recalibrated what’s attainable for college athletes in the age of NIL (Name, Image, and Likeness), lining up an endorsement collection to rival even professional stars. But at the core of her success is a uniquely potent combination of on-court brilliance and off-court saleability, with brands eager to hitch their wagons to her authentic, relatable personality. The Swoosh led the charge when it created signature GT Hustle 3 PE sneakers in her honor , a feat reserved for established pros , while Gatorade made history when it signed her to its first student-athlete pact ever.
What sets Bueckers’ approach apart is her far-reaching vision beyond what is known as traditional sponsorships. Her equity deal with the new Unrivaled women’s basketball league was a seismic shift, thrusting her into the role of both ambassador and stakeholder in the sport’s development. It dovetails with partnerships with lifestyle brands such as Bose and Dunkin’, which tap her frequent-girl-next-door appeal to wider audiences. Industry analysts say her alliances always pave new ground; one marketing executive noted, “She markets not only products, she’s pushing forward the entire ecosystem of women’s sports.”
The financial ramifications of these partnerships are only expanding, thanks to the merchandise from the UConn NIL Store and a unique venture that has Paige already cashing in on her “Paige Buckets” trademark. Rather than being a large-scale one-off cash in like a number of peers, Bueckers has created a patchwork of brand opportunities that form an interconnected network designed to ensure she’s generating income long after her collegiate eligibility is up.
Which High School Did Paige Bueckers Attend?
Even before she drew national attention at UConn, Bueckers was building her basketball legacy at Hopkins High School in a suburb of Minneapolis. Her success at the plate helped make the Royals’ program a must-see destination as she led the team to three consecutive state championship games, where it won two titles, while she rewrote the record books in Minnesota. Her sophomore season a perfect 32-0 campaign , first unveiled her trademark clutch gene, last-second shots a matter of course across the top of the ESPN scroll.
Hopkins coach Brian Cosgriff likes to tell the story of how Bueckers changed the culture around their program: “Practices became events. It was college coaches lined up just to watch her run drills.” Despite the increasing buzz, she kept her nose to the grindstone, often staying for hours after games to work on her shot. This dedication followed her into the classroom, balancing AP courses with her athletic commitments and helping to lay the groundwork for the academic honors she would receive later at UConn.

What Is Paige Bueckers’ Net Worth and Salary?
Bueckers’ financial portfolio speaks to an athlete who used the same precision she reserved for her jump shot to monetize her celebrity. Though NCAA rules forbid her from making salary, her NIL deals have created a lifelong net worth between $1.5–$2 million through very carefully crafted deals. Her $1.4 million per year valuation from On3 provides the foundation, but her true innovation is in how she’s diversified that revenue equity positions, intellectual property holdings, advisory roles creating so many appreciating assets.
Her foreseeable WNBA rookie contract (about $76,000 per year is the projected amount) is almost an afterthought when you factor in her existing framework. The “Paige Buckets” trademark permits them to have full control over merchandise lines, and the Overtime Select advisory position gives her insight and income while shaping the next generation of players. Particularly visionary, say financial experts, is her Unrivaled league ownership.
Her roadmap suggests earnings might soon exceed those of veteran WNBA stars. With most NIL deals providing multiyear commitments and new opportunities like her Panini America trading cards carving out collectible value, Bueckers has manufactured financial stability without even turning professional. It’s a business model that future athletes will surely follow , one where on-court success and off-court business savvy amplify one another.
